Quote:
Originally Posted by Shabzhere View Post
The stretch from Chitradurga to Hubli ( some 20 kms before) is uneven at places, so you might get a wobbly sensation if doing high speeds. I experienced it when i was doing around 120'ish but things moved better when i dropped my speed by 20 kmph.
Its been that way since past 5+ years now.

They have repaired the wobbly section just before the Bankapura toll booth but not the one between Shiggaon till Hubli (Around 40 kms).

This wobbling is mainly due to the surface becoming uneven due to heavy vehicles and when one tends to change lanes in cars, it results in this wobble when passing over the TopDeadCenter and BottomDeadCenter of these undulations .

This is the case mainly when driving towards Pune. When driving towards Bangalore, the roads are quite OK except near Haveri for a very short stretch.

Quote:
Originally Posted by coriollis View Post
I will be starting from Pune at 4 AM on 13th Nov. I am planning to reach Mysore (again ambitious) by 8 PM.
Not at all ambitious. With Sedate speeds also, this is manageable along with usual breaks.

Quote:
One query about route though...
What is the better option? To divert at Hiriyur or at Dabaspet ? Or drive all the way upto Nelmangla and take NICE road and then NH275 ?
Hiriyur - Huliyar - Nelligere - Nagamangala - Pandavapura - Srirangapatna - Mysore should be a better choice.

There is no point to drive all the way till NICE for the following reasons:
  • Hiriyur to NICE Entrance is an easy 2.5 hours Drive with the last Leg between Tumkur to NICE a little slower than the rest (of 160 kms this will be 40 kms)
  • Again from NICE you will take 3 hours for sure to reach Mysore which means 6 hours from Hiriyur
  • By taking the Hiriyur option, you bypass Bangalore and surroundings completely
  • You also avoid driving on the Bangalore-Mysore SH17 where you will have to pass key towns of Ramnagara, Channapatna, Maddur, Mandya etc and you don't want to do that after that tiring drive
Just in case you decide to halt for the night and break your journey -
  • Apoorva Resorts at Davanagere
  • Naveen Regency at Chitradurga
  • Naveen Regency at Tumkur (If you want to pass via NICE)
